Vilde Frang - Prokofiev & Sibelius: Violin Concertos
EMI Classics is pleased to announce the signing of Norwegian violinist Vilde Frang. Her first recording features the Sibelius Violin Concerto and three Humoresques and Prokofievs Violin Concerto No. 1, recorded live with the WDR Sinfonieorchester Köln and conductor Thomas Søndergård. This is Vilde Frang's debut album at the age of 22. London Symphony Orchestra: Émigré Series
20 September 2008 to 8 May 2009 Highlights of the LSO Émigré Series: The Émigré series, which runs until May 2009, focuses on compositions by Prokofiev, Rachmaninoff, Stravinsky, Bartók, Schoenberg and Korngold. Entitled " Emigration & Displacement: Composers in Exile ", it features music written in the composers' homelands, during times of travel or temporary residences elsewhere, and in the new homeland or on their return. J.S. Bach - Air on the G String, Sarah Chang
A recipient of the Avery Fisher Career Grant and the 1993 Gramophone award as 'Young Artist of the Year', Sarah is an exclusive recording artist with EMI Classics. Her first album 'Debut', featuring virtuoso pieces by Sarasate, Paganini, Elgar and Prokofiev, was released in 1992 and quickly reached the Billboard chart of classical best-sellers.
